Step 1: Assessment and Leak Detection

We’ll use specialized equipment to detect the source of the leak and assess the damage. This step is crucial in determining the extent of the damage and identifying the necessary steps to repair it.

Step 2: Water Removal

We’ll use our powerful pumps and vacuums to remove the water from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use our specialized equipment to dry out the affected area and remove any excess moisture. This step is essential in preventing further damage and ensuring that your home is safe and healthy.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

We’ll use our state-of-the-art equipment to clean and disinfect the affected area. This step is critical in removing any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may be present in the water.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

We’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, or cabinets.

Aquarium Leak Water Removal Cost in Cerritos, CA

The cost of Aquarium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cerritos,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water removed.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ment needed.
Cleaning and disinfection $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ed.
Restoration and repair $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air.
Equipment rental and transportation $500 – $2,000 The type and quantity of equipment needed.
